Bureaucratics Revisited
Jan Banning
Bureaucratics Revisited is a fully revised, expanded edition of the acclaimed book Bureaucratics, first published in 2008. To create the seminal body of work contained in that book, Dutch photographic artist Jan Banning undertook an unprecedented global journey through the offices of those who wield state power. Over the course of five years and across eight countries, Banning trained his lens on the largely unnoticed human face of bureaucracy.The environmental portraits are defined by their square format, frontal perspective, and deadpan clarity. Each is taken from the eye level of the citizen entering the office. The result is a subtle dialogue between the roles of the office as a formal, performative representation of government authority, and as the civil servant’s private (work) space. At once an anthropological study and a work of visual poetry, Bureaucratics offers an ironic yet humane exploration of the administrative machineries that govern our societies while remaining largely invisible—and the individuals who sustain these.This new edition expands upon the original publication with previously unpublished photographs from the initial series, rare images from the early proto-series The Office (Mozambique), and selected works from later series that continue Bureaucratics’ distinctive visual language. The new edition spans twelve countries in total. In the new text, Banning reflects on the origins of this exceptional project and its trajectory over the past two decades.Since first being exhibited, Bureaucratics has travelled extensively, appearing in 45 museums, galleries, and other venues across eighteen countries on five continents. The work has been acquired by renowned museums, institutional and private collections, published in approximately twenty countries, and discussed in several academic studies.Bureaucratics stands as a landmark of conceptual documentary photography—a meticulous and humane portrayal of the universal apparatus of government, and the individuals who bring this quietly to life.
